Transaction fa56bc64bf5689c416b4232a232e3ebc008868c4f5b750cbd34e557e5ea38148
1 Input
1 Output
-
fa56bc64bf5689c416b4232a232e3ebc008868c4f5b750cbd34e557e5ea38148:0
- value
- 2984405
- script pubkey
- OP_0 OP_PUSHBYTES_20 f1a0d1045dbb587f165a380c24332b7d203c2055
- address
- bc1q7xsdzpzahdv879j68qxzgvet05srcgz432w36g